The results of the 2025 American Consumer Awards in the 'Automotive' category, organized by the American Consumer Right Association and managed by the American Consumer Assessment, have been announced for the New York region.
These awards aim to uphold consumers' fundamental rights by sharing results based on consumer evaluations, providing objective and valuable information, and promoting the qualitative enhancement of consumers' lives.
Evaluations for the 2025 American Consumer Awards 'Automotive' category were conducted from March to June, and we conducted an evaluation through review platforms. The evaluation criteria included facility standards, staff service quality, pricing transparency, accessibility and customer responsiveness. A total of 10 businesses received awards in this category.

PORTLAND, Maine, July 23,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Northeast Bank (the 'Bank') (NASDAQ: NBN), a Maine-based bank, announced today it will release its fiscal 2025 fourth quarter earnings results on Monday, July 28, 2025. Following the release, the Bank will host a conference call with a simultaneous webcast at 10:00 a.m. ET on Thursday, July 31, 2025. The conference call will be hosted by Rick Wayne, President and Chief Executive Officer, Richard Cohen, Chief Financial Officer, and Pat Dignan, Chief Operating Officer. KO's Strategic Pricing Drives Q2 Beat: What's Next for Investors?

The Coca-Cola Company 's KO strong second-quarter 2025 results were driven by a strategic emphasis on pricing, offset by a 1% volume decline. The company reported 5% organic revenue growth and EPS of 87 cents, beating expectations by 3 cents. A 6% increase in price/mix, primarily from pricing actions, played a pivotal role in delivering solid revenues amid choppy market conditions, including adverse weather and consumer pressure in key regions, like India and Mexico. The company's pricing strength was particularly evident in North America and Latin America, where Coca-Cola Zero Sugar and premium innovations performed well despite softer volumes. Coca-Cola remains confident in its ability to sustain momentum, highlighting the effectiveness of its 'all-weather' strategy. Management emphasized rapid pivots and granular market-specific execution to address shifting dynamics, whether through affordability plays like refillables in Mexico or digital customer platforms in India. Strategic marketing, including campaigns like 'Share a Coke' and innovative product launches such as Sprite + Tea, continues to enhance consumer engagement and drive value share, which increased for the 17th consecutive quarter. For investors, the key takeaway is Coca-Cola's proven ability to manage pricing intelligently while navigating global macro volatility. With refreshed guidance of 5-6% organic revenue growth and 8% EPS growth (currency-neutral), supported by strong free cash flow and margin expansion, the company is well-positioned to weather uncertainty. Continued reinvestment in capabilities, AI-driven pricing tools and robust execution across emerging and developed markets provides confidence in KO's ability to deliver consistent, long-term shareholder value. Smart Pricing Tactics: How PEP & KDP Are Challenging KO's Playbook In the competitive beverage landscape, Coca-Cola's pricing strategy faces strong challenges from key rivals like PepsiCo Inc. PEP and Keurig Dr Pepper Inc. KDP, both of which are making calculated moves to protect margins and drive growth. PepsiCo continues to lean into its premiumization strategy, zero-sugar innovation and value-pack formats to navigate inflation and evolving consumer preferences. The company has effectively balanced price increases with brand equity, particularly through its strong performance in the Gatorade and Pepsi Zero Sugar lines, while expanding distribution across retail and foodservice channels. Keurig Dr Pepper, on the other hand, is leveraging portfolio diversification and digital shelf analytics to refine price-pack architecture across its coffee and CSD (carbonated soft drink) segments. The company has focused on strategic pricing in single-serve coffee and enhanced retail execution in flavored sodas like Dr Pepper and Canada Dry. With a mix of value-driven offerings and data-led promotional tactics, KDP is sharpening its competitive edge, particularly in North America's value-conscious beverage market. Alberta pays out $143M to company over coal policy reversal

Alberta is paying out more than $140 million to end one of five lawsuits launched against it over its coal mining policies. A notice published online by Atrum Coal says the company has agreed to end its lawsuit and surrender its land back to the province in exchange for the payment. The company says it received just under $137 million last week and will receive another $6 million after it completes some reclamation work. Atrum was one of two companies suing the province that announced last month that settlements were reached, but the other, Evolve Power, has yet to share details. The companies are among five that are suing Alberta for a collective $16 billion. They argue that Alberta effectively expropriated their land after it suddenly reinstated its long-standing coal policy in 2022 less than two years after it was lifted and companies had been encouraged at that time to buy land for potential mining projects.
